Program Description:
The School of Information Sciences (SIS) offers a program to prepare information professionals for work in all types of libraries and information centers. The program of study includes a graduate curriculum leading to the Master of Science (M.S.) degree. The program is accredited by the American Library Association. The School of Information Sciences also participates in the college-wide doctoral program (Ph.D.) in Communication and Information.
